Junior Accountant
V Rao & Gopi Chartered Accountants is hiring a Junior Accountant in Hyderabad to manage end-to-end bookkeeping and financial reporting for clients. The role involves performing bank reconciliations, monthly closures, and preparing MIS reports using Tally, Zoho Books, and Excel. Candidates will work on-site and support senior management while gaining exposure to diverse business models. It is a growth-oriented position suitable for finance professionals seeking long-term stability.
